"Nothing is Scarier than a Halloween Brat" by _brainchild_
It was Halloween night, and Walda the Baby Kacheek was sitting at home with a glum expression on her face. While her friends were out trick-or-treating, she was being punished for misbehavior which may or may not have included a chocolate-induced sugar rush. “Grounded on Halloween!” she exclaimed to herself. “This stinks!” While her older siblings went to a Halloween party, Walda had been left in the care of her cousin Anjetta, who didn’t care for spooky gatherings or Halloween in general. Bored, Walda went into the living room, where she picked up her crayons and her coloring book. She was scribbling orange over a pumpkin when she heard a snore. Anjetta had fallen asleep on the couch. With a mischievous smile, Walda had an idea. If Anjetta was not watching Walda, then the latter could go anywhere she wanted, and no one would find out, as long as she got back before her sisters got home. Walda gleefully put on her faerie costume and pranced out the door. She found her friends walking along the sidewalk, pillowcases containing candy in hand. “Hey!” she exclaimed. “I’m here!” “Weren’t you grounded?” one of her friends asked. Walda paused. “You said you were grounded,” another pointed out. “Did you sneak out?” “Maybe...” “Go home. Your family is probably worried about you. Don’t worry---we’ll save you some chocolate.”

Who Rules the Haunted Woods?
The Haunted Woods encompass an absolutely massive swath of land in southern Neopia. From the Werelupe Woods to the halls of Castle Nox, most of the Haunted Woods is ruled by local Lords, Ladies, and other kinds of nobility who govern their own patches of land. While the Haunted Woods has no formally declared ruler, is there someone who stands out above the rest as a de facto leader? I’ll be evaluating the arguments for and against the leadership of a number of powerful Neopians who call the Haunted Woods their home.
